A telescopic gantry crane stands out for its unique capacity to extend and retract, a feature that significantly enhances its versatility. This adjustability allows it to handle tasks that fixed-length cranes cannot, providing customized lifting operations tailored to the specific needs of a project. By being able to retract, these cranes optimize space, allowing more equipment or goods to be stored when not in use and reducing obstructions often faced in tight spaces. This flexibility does not compromise on performance, as these cranes are engineered to maintain stability and control even when fully extended.

When discussing trustworthiness, it's paramount to consider the safety enhancements native to modern telescopic gantry cranes. Manufacturers prioritize safety with features such as anti-sway systems, emergency stop functions, and precision control technologies to mitigate risks. These advancements build confidence in users and stakeholders alike, ensuring that operations run smoothly and safely. Furthermore, adherence to international standards such as the ISO 9001 for quality management systems underscores the commitment to maintaining high safety and reliability benchmarks.
